To pursue a medical malpractice claim, you need to be able prove that the healthcare professionals involved in your case did not meet a recognized standard of care. Your lawyer will go through your medical records, talk with the healthcare professionals who are involved in your case, and consult with medical experts to determine what a competent provider in the same situation would have done. They will also look into the policies of the hospital where your birth occurred to determine whether any of these policies were violated.
Be aware that the time limit for medical malpractice claims is two years in New York. Therefore, you should seek legal counsel as soon as you can.
In addition to healthcare providers, individuals who could be held liable in a birth injury lawsuit comprise pharmaceutical companies and pharmacists. These individuals are liable under a theory of product liability for selling an unsafe drug when used as directed. They may be held accountable in a case based on negligence in the sense that they fail to adequately inform doctors about the risks associated certain drugs.

A successful lawsuit requires proving four crucial elements such as duty of care and breach of this duty, causation, and damages. A skilled Portland birth injury lawyer will work with medical experts to collect and analyze evidence for your case, and then put together a convincing argument to show that negligence occurred.
Medical records are the most crucial evidence in a medical malpractice lawsuit Your attorney will carefully review the records to determine if the healthcare provider was in compliance during labor and birth. Expert witness testimony may also be required to establish that the medical professional was acting outside of the standards of care, causing your child's injuries.
